How Kintnersville’s History Shapes Tree Care Today

Kintnersville began as a rural crossroads community in the 18th century, with life centered on farming and local mills. That history still affects the trees and landscapes here, from old specimen trees on original homesteads to root damage around stone foundations and windbreaks that have outgrown their space.

Mature Canopy Trees Near Historic Buildings

In areas such as Kintnersville Hill and along Old Bethlehem Road, many property owners deal with aging maples and oaks planted close to stone structures. As these trees decline, limbs can drop over roofs and root systems may press against foundations, creating real safety concerns.

Our network of tree service pros addresses these problems with selective crown reduction, targeted cabling, and planned root pruning to help prevent repeat issues.

Power Line Conflicts on Narrow Rural Roads

The mature tree cover in the area adds beauty and value, but it can also interfere with utility lines and block roadways. If branches are left unchecked, they may cause outages or create dangerous conditions during winter storms.

Local pros manage these situations with directional pruning, careful bucket truck placement for tight spaces, and coordination with utility requirements that fit the infrastructure found throughout Bucks County.

Storm Damage on Exposed Ridge Properties

Years of wind exposure have left many ridge-top properties in Kintnersville more vulnerable during severe weather.

Skilled professionals respond with hazard tree evaluations, preventive crown thinning, and emergency cleanup steps that improve stability and reduce risk around the property.

Invasive Plant Pressure on Wooded Lots

The Easton area’s climate supports fast growth of invasive species such as ailanthus, Norway maple, and multiflora rose on wooded acreage.

Experienced crews address these threats with removal plans that may include mechanical extraction, targeted treatment when appropriate, and native replanting to support healthier long-term growth.

Tight Access on Private Drives

Steep grades and narrow gravel lanes are common in Kintnersville, which makes equipment placement and safe operation more difficult.

Compact machinery and rigging systems help crews complete the work efficiently while limiting disruption to lawns and surrounding landscape features.

To keep costs manageable, focus on pruning branches that create safety risks near structures, book work during slower winter months, coordinate with neighbors to lower travel and setup costs, and handle urgent hazards before cosmetic trimming.

Removing deadwood helps prevent limbs from falling during ice storms, crown reduction can lessen wind damage to structures, utility line clearance reduces the risk of outages, cutting back branches over driveways improves access, and cabling can support split trunks on valuable specimen trees.

Tree removal may be the safer option when a tree has severe decay, leans dangerously toward a building, has been badly damaged in a storm, or shows root disease that affects stability. Because Kintnersville has many mature trees and sees strong weather events, a professional evaluation can help decide whether selective pruning or removal offers better protection for your property.

For most species, late winter into early spring is the ideal window, before new leaves appear, although hazardous limbs should be handled right away. Heavy pruning is usually best avoided during peak spring growth, and non-emergency work should also take local bird nesting periods into account in the township’s wooded areas.
